Highlights
Are people in Lompoc older or younger than people in Alameda?
- The Median Age in Lompoc is 6.8 years younger than in Alameda.

Are housing costs cheaper in Lompoc or Alameda?
- Lompoc housing costs are 58.7% less expensive than Alameda hous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Lompoc or Alameda?
- The average commute for residents of Lompoc is 8.3 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Alameda.
